Skip to content

Commit fd05a9b

Browse files
fix(screenshare): Windows screenshare tracker crash
* fix windows screen-share tracker crash * Bump version
1 parent 406ad1f commit fd05a9b

File tree

3 files changed

+6
-2
lines changed

3 files changed

+6
-2
lines changed

package-lock.json

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"jitsi-meet-electron-utils",
3-
"version": "2.0.4",
3+
"version": "2.0.5",
44
"description": "Utilities for jitsi-meet-electron project",
55
"main": "index.js",
66
"scripts": {

screensharing/main.js

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-94,6 +94,10 @@ class ScreenShareMainHook {
9494
}
9595
});
9696

97+
this._screenShareTracker.on('closed', () => {
98+
this._screenShareTracker = undefined;
99+
});
100+
97101
// Prevent newly created window to take focus from main application.
98102
this._screenShareTracker.once('ready-to-show', () => {
99103
if (this._screenShareTracker && !this._screenShareTracker.isDestroyed()) {

0 commit comments

Comments
 (0)